【推荐1】Hand gestures(手势)are part of body language. The same hand gesture means different things in different countries. Here are some examples.
Thumbs(拇指)up In America, you can give somebody the thumbs up if you think something is very good. You can also use it when you’re in need of a ride. But in Germany, it means “one”. And giving someone the thumbs up is asking for trouble(麻烦)in some Middle Eastern countries, like Iran and Iraq.
The “V” sign In China, the “V” sign is very popular. People like to make the sign when they take pictures. It makes their faces look cuter and smaller. In America, this gesture means “victory(胜利)”. But in the UK, it is rude to make this sign when the back of the hand is facing the other person.
The dog call In America, the dog call is used to call someone to come closer to you. But in China, this gesture isn’t welcome because they only do this to pets. It’s very rude if you do it to people.
The “OK” sign In most of the English-speaking countries, you can use the “OK” sign if you want to let people know you’re alright. But it means something different in other countries. For example, it means “money” in Japan while “zero” or “nothing” in France.
When you visit a new country, it is important to learn what the gestures mean so that you won’t offend(冒犯)anyone.

【推荐2】Dragons are not real animals, but look like a combination(组合体)of many animals such as snakes, fish and deer. They have two horns(角)and a long moustache(胡子). With fantastic powers, they fly in the sky or swim in the sea. They can make rain, too. The Chinese dragon is a symbol of strength and good luck. The emperors of ancient China loved dragons. Their clothes were covered with pictures of dragons.
We are proud to call ourselves the “descendants(传人)of the dragon”. In Chinese, “excellent” people are often called “dragons”. A number of Chinese sayings and idioms talk about dragons. For example, “hoping one’s child will become a dragon” means hoping he or she will be successful.
It is said that people born in the Year of the Dragon have certain characteristics. They are creative, confident, brave and quick—tempered. There are some famous “dragons” who have done excellent things, for example, Deng Xiaoping, the famous businessman Li Jiacheng and the movie star Zhao Wei. They are all very successful.
There are also some traditional festivals about dragons in China, such as Dragon Head—Raising Day and Dragon Boat Festival. We have different kinds of activities to celebrate them. These two festivals come every year, but the Year of the Dragon comes every twelve years.
The dragon is very important in Chinese culture. As the “descendants of the dragon”, it is necessary for us to know the views on dragons in our culture. It can help us understand why our parents always want us to be “dragons”.
